Web9 okt. 2024 · Hip arthroscopy, sometimes called a “hip scope,” is a minimally invasive procedure in which an orthopedic surgeon uses an arthroscope to examine the inside of the hip joint. This procedure allows the surgeon to diagnose the cause of hip pain or other problems in your joint. Some hip conditions may also be treated arthroscopically.

WebWe recommend joint replacement surgery when your joint is extensively damaged and your symptoms don’t improve with conservative treatments. Advanced arthritis is the top reason for joint replacement surgery.
